Who are we?

Exe Mortgages is based in the very heart of Ottery St Mary, in Silver Street just a stone’s throw from the imposing parish church. We’re a small team of experienced advisors who aim to provide the best service possible for our clients, many of whom are very local to the office. We take pride in sourcing exactly the right mortgages and other financial products to suit individual needs. We know this is appreciated, as the majority of our work comes from recommendation – surely the best way to do business!

How do we work?

We’re very approachable and very down to earth. We know that the mortgage maze can be difficult to navigate. We also understand that people are busier than ever and don’t always have enough spare time to sort out their mortgage. Our job is to magically take away the stresses and strains, and deal with the whole process for our clients. We can help with first-time buyers, second mortgages, re-mortgaging, equity release and lifetime mortgages – as well as many of the insurances people might need. We don’t hard-sell these, rather we guide and make recommendations.

Supporting local

At Exe Mortgages we are all firm believers in supporting local – local shops, local businesses and local people – as a company we sponsor a young footballer, cricketer and two young athletes, all from the local area and all at the start of their careers. We also dig deep for local charities including Hospiscare, which is such a huge part of the East Devon community, and well-loved in Ottery St Mary.
